Smaller Embraer E190 and E195 fleet of aircraft are being used initially, with no more than 118 seats on the larger model, allowing Breeze to be more competitive on routes with traditionally low demand. NGPA Expo - February 9-10 in PSP Booth 525, Women in Aviation - February 23-25 in LGB - Booth 549, TPNx April 21-22 in MCO, Currently hiring E190/195 and A220 First Officers, E190/195 Captains, and Australian Pilots that hold or have previously held an E-3 visa, New hire classes every month for the E190/195 and A220, Scheduled passenger service on the E190/195 flying consists of day trips (no overnights) with limited flying on Tuesday and Wednesday, Charter business is very robust on the E190/195 Charter flights may operate any day of the week, A220 operates a traditional schedule 7 days per week, Significant growth and expansion planned over the next 5 years, Breeze flies to 30+ cities from coast to coast, Eight A220s delivered as of August 2022 - 73 more to be delivered and options for 40 more, Ejet fleet projected to grow to 30 by 2025, A220 fleet is projected to grow to nearly 60 by the end of 2025, A new training center opened in SLC with one E190/195 simulator and one A220 simulator, $200 million in funding was raised in August of 2021. One of the never-ending challenges pilots face in their career is deciding the domiciles they will work from. Pilots with higher rankings often have their pick of assignments over more recent hires, allowing them to have better control over their flying schedule, for example. Crew domiciles end up being staffed by more junior pilots due to cost of living, quality of life considerations, aircraft types operated out that base, where pilots typically fly to out of a base, and trip schedules. All applicants are required to have at least 1,500 total hours with 1,000 hours of experience flying fixed-wing turbine aircraft, regardless of whether applying for the Embraer or Airbus fleet. Pilots looking to fly the Embraer fleet, however, will have to have a type rating for the Embraer E170/E190 while Airbus applicants are not required to have an A220 type rating since the aircraft is so new.
